On Sun, Apr 29, 2007 at 10:02:57AM +0000, Antti Kantee wrote:
> Probably should give a way to specify rest of the ssh options.

Like, for example, using a made-up hostname listed in .ssh/options
with the real hostname in the HostName, together with a collection of
other options you want to take effect for that session?

The same trick works well with a number of other programs (rsync, cvs,
monotone, ..) that can invoke ssh.
